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Lavandería en Farm Hill

Cuál es el apartamento con Lavandería más barato en Farm Hill?

Actualmente el apartamento con Lavandería más accequible en Farm Hill está en Perry Street Studios listado en $2,050.

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Lavandería en Farm Hill?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Lavandería en Farm Hill es $2,535.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Lavandería más grande en Farm Hill?

A día de hoy el apartamento con Lavandería y más metros cuadrados en Farm Hill una unidad de 1,102 a partir de $2,632 en The Millton.
